Grinding Gear Games (GGG) has added a new Renown system to the Mercenaries of Trarthus league in Path of Exile, enhancing the endgame experience and adding strategic depth to mercenary encounters PoE 1 Currency.

How the Renown System Works
The Renown system tracks your reputation among the Trarthan mercenaries you face in Wraeclast. Each time you defeat a Mercenary, your Renown rank increases by one, up to a maximum of three. Conversely, if you lose a fight or back out—which means inspecting a Mercenary’s gear and skills but then leaving without engaging—the Renown rank decreases by one.Backing out without returning to fight the Mercenary causes your Renown to drop because the mercenaries spread rumors of your cowardice. However, if you return later to fight the same Mercenary, you can do so without penalty.

Impact of Renown on Gameplay
Your Renown rank directly influences the difficulty and quality of Mercenaries you encounter. Higher Renown increases the chance of facing Infamous Mercenaries, elite foes who come from distant lands to challenge you. These Infamous Mercenaries are tougher, equipped with better rare items, always carry at least one unique item, and are the only source of Infamous modifier items—a new type of powerful affix introduced in this league.Additionally, Infamous Mercenaries appear more frequently in maps with a higher number of modifiers, rewarding players who take on more challenging content.

Community Reception and Strategic Implications
The Renown system encourages players to consistently engage with Mercenary fights rather than farming or avoiding them. Some community members note that with only three ranks, the system might be shallow, as players can quickly reach maximum Renown. However, it effectively discourages loot fishing where players inspect Mercenaries’ gear without fighting.By tying better loot and tougher enemies to Renown, GGG adds a risk-reward element that makes Mercenary encounters more meaningful and dynamic.

Visual Indicators
Infamous Mercenaries are visually distinct, featuring a golden border around their portrait and the Infamous prefix before their archetype name, making it easy for players to identify these elite foes at a glance PoE Currency buy.
